What is the method of sterilization?
The shields and conformers are sterilized using validated ETO ethylene oxide gas following the standard hospital sterilization protocol for plastic devices. Corneal Surgical Shields and Post-op conformers are packaged in Defend ETO sterilized pouches ready for use. How is the Corneal Surgical Shield used? To use the Corneal Surgical Shield, if the patient is awake, the surgeon should first instill a drop or two of topical anesthetic into the eye. Grasping the shield by the handle, slide the shield gently under the superior lid and then depress inferior lid until the shield slips into position. If using the shield without a handle, a silicone suction cup is supplied for easy insertion and removal. What are the Corneal Surgical Shields made from? Corneal Surgical Shields are produced from PMMA black opaque and clear plastic. The quality and finish of these shields and conformers are exceptional. How many sizes are available?
